Question
Differentiate the following functions with respect to x: $\sin(3\text{x}+5)$
✓
Answer
Consider $\text{y}=\sin(3\text{x}+5)$ Differentiate y with the respect to x, $\frac{\text{dy}}{\text{dx}}=\frac{\text{d}}{\text{dx}}\big(\sin(3\text{x}+5)\big)$ $=\cos(3\text{x}+5)\frac{\text{d}}{\text{dx}}(3\text{x}+5)$ [using chain rule] $=\cos(3\text{x}+5)\times[3(1)+0]$ $=3\cos(3\text{x}+5)$ Hence, the solution is $\frac{\text{d}}{\text{dx}}(\sin(3\text{x}+5))=3\cos(3\text{x}+5)$
